The PRAXIS Speech Language Pathology exam (test code 5331) assesses knowledge across five major content areas: foundations of speech-language pathology, prevention and assessment, treatment and intervention, professional practices, and clinical supervision. The exam includes questions on anatomy and physiology of speech and hearing, language development, articulation and phonology, fluency disorders, voice disorders, and swallowing disorders. Understanding the exam's scope and weighting is essential for effective test preparation.
Many test-takers struggle with the anatomical and physiological foundations of speech and hearing, as well as distinguishing between similar disorders and their treatment approaches. Clinical application questions—which require connecting theoretical knowledge to real-world scenarios—also present difficulty for students who've primarily memorized facts. Personalized tutoring helps identify your specific weak areas and builds targeted strategies to master complex concepts like differential diagnosis and evidence-based intervention planning.
